Glencairn Museum is pleased to welcome Yale psychologist and author Dr. Zorana

Ivcevic Pringle for an inspiring lecture exploring the science and lived experience of

creativity.

 

In this thought-provoking talk, Dr. Ivcevic Pringle challenges the myths that prevent

many people from seeing themselves as creative. Drawing on decades of research

behind The Creativity Choice, she shows that creativity is not a rare talent nor a sudden

flash of inspiration reserved for a fortunate few. Instead, it develops through sustained

effort, experimentation, and “problem finding,” learning to recognize what is worth

making and imagining it from multiple perspectives.

 

She also examines how thinking and feeling work together in the creative process.

Emotions such as uncertainty, frustration, and excitement are not obstacles to overcome,

but meaningful signals that can guide creative work forward. By reframing creativity as

something that grows through action and interaction with materials, audiences, and

institutions, this lecture invites you to see creative expression, from art to everyday

problem-solving, as deeply human and learnable.
